**OVERVIEW**

**CANDIDATE QUALIFICATIONS**
- Minimum 3- 5 years’ experience in creating maps in ESRI ArcGIS 10.x, ArcGIS Pro, and ArcGIS Online
- Experience in creating technical schematics in AutoCAD.
- Experience with ArcGIS Collector app
- Computer kn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int, Teams)

**RESPONSIBILITIES**
- Prepare geospatial data, maps, and tabular data.
- Maintain company standards and procedures under the direction of the Geomatics Lead.
- Compile spatial data sets from sources such as GPS, field observations, environmental monitoring, satellite images, and LiDAR.
- Demonstrate the ability to meet tight deadlines and work under pressure.
- Collaborate with GIS team and scientists to ensure consistent and high-quality GIS services are maintained.
- Other duties as directed by your direct supervisor or manager.
